Well as you can probably guess I live here in Canada and I have lived here more than two years, although I moved from Israel, where I spent more than half of my life, and before I immigrated to Israel from Kishinev, were I was born. Now I live in Oakville, located in Halton Region on Lake Ontario, halfway between Toronto and Hamilton. I suppose if I had to describe Oakville, the first thing I would say is that it's absolutely quietest place, and maybe even one of the charming towns I guess, especially, the lake shore. It's also considered one of the most densely populated areas of Canada, but despite of it there are a lot of green peaceful places, where you can relax and have a fun. For example, near my neighborhood is located huge Bronte park with a beautiful camp side and a lot of wildlife. In summer month we have a prominent theatre almost every week. Another significant characteristic is that Oakville offers examples of mixed architecture. Actually you can find typical old houses surrounded by new modern neighborhoods and even few skyscrapers. As I have already mentioned, the most beautiful part of Oakville, in my opinion is Lake shore area with old, quiet streets, absolutely stunning nineteenth century buildings, beautiful outdoor parks, old Harbour, and excellent food.
